POPCORN
Login
Marja-Leena Junker
IMDb
Bio
Known For
Shadow of the Vampire
2000
Wolfkin
2023
Skin Walker
2019
Barrage
2017
W
2003
X on a Map
2009
Wedding Night - End of the Song
1992
The Unemployment Club
2001